Easy as in famous Well-known and often spoken about, typically describing something or someone in a way that seems remarkable or extraordinary, although it may involve elements of fiction or myth. Clear All
8 Example Sentences Showcasing the Meaning of 'Legendary'
The legendary tale of King Arthur and the Knights of the Round Table has captivated readers for centuries.
In the world of fantasy literature, dragons are often depicted as legendary creatures with immense power.
The legendary singer's concert was sold out within minutes.
The legendary chef's restaurant had a waiting list for months.
Her legendary kindness was felt by everyone in the community.
The legendary creature was said to lurk in the depths of the forest.
The legendary warrior's weapon became a symbol of strength and honor.
The legendary martial artist's skills were unmatched in the ring.
